Trinidad James

Nicholaus Joseph Williams (born September 24, 1987), better known by his stage name Trinidad James (often stylized as Trinidad Jame$), is a Trinidadian-American rapper and songwriter. In 2012, he signed a recording contract with Def Jam Recordings. The label dropped him in 2014 when he failed to release an album, although he continues to release music as an independent artist and signed to Artist Publishing Group for songwriting in 2018. In the late 2010s and early 2020s, he focused on a career in songwriting and production. He currently writes and co-produces records for primarily female artists including City Girls, Kehlani, Flo Milli, Queen Naija, and Lakeyah, among others. He has writing or production credits on Mark Ronson's "Uptown Funk", Fifty Fifty's "Barbie Dreams", and Bhad Bhabie's "Hi Bich".
